President Bhandari requests voters for enthusiastic participation in polls
The president said the elections have historical importance in institutionalising the federal democratic republic.Post Report
President Bidya Devi Bhandari has requested voters to participate enthusiastically in the federal and provincial elections scheduled for Sunday.
In a message issued on the elections eve, the head of the state said, “As voting is the highest exercise of civil rights, I request all my sisters and brothers to participate enthusiastically.”
The president further said the elections have historical importance in institutionalising the federal democratic republic.
“House of Representatives and provincial assembly elections are being held tomorrow. The elections have historical importance in institutionalising the federal democratic republic guaranteed by the constitution that was formulated by the constituent assembly,” the president said in the message.
“Democratic systems and institutions gradually become more accountable to the people through the general elections held in a fair and free environment. This helps to establish the good governance and transparency that the people are looking for. The national goals of peace, stability and prosperity can be achieved only through a healthy and strong democracy.”
According to the president, the most beautiful aspect of democracy is the government run by representatives elected by the people.
Since the restoration of democracy in 1990, the nation will hold its seventh election to elect lawmakers (including the two elections for the Constituent Assembly) on Sunday. This will be the second federal and provincial elections since the promulgation of the 2015 constitution.
